About the role

Department Faculty Research Operations - Sciences At the University of York, operational research support is delivered through a single, interconnected institution-wide community of practice through Faculty-facing teams line managed from the Research, Innovation and Knowledge Exchange (RIKE) directorate. The three teams (Sciences, Social Sciences, and Arts & Humanities) provide end-to-end operational support for externally-funded research and research-related projects, throughout the project lifecycle. Pre-Award (working with academics to create budgets, handling internal approvals processes and project management of submission process). Post-Award (accepting awards, setting up budgets and managing finances throughout lifecycle of grant). Environment (supporting strategic thinking around funding, helping academics to engage with new opportunities, and supporting the creation of a strong departmental research environment). Role As part of a faculty team, the successful candidate will ensure a responsive service to assist academic staff in the preparation and submission of research and research-related grant applications, in line with university and funder requirements, including: managing a complex portfolio of applications, carrying out accurate Full Economic Costings using University systems, initiating and proactively managing all associated internal processes; providing support and advice on matters escalated by more junior colleagues; working flexibly to provide support and cover for colleagues where required. Skills, Experience & Qualifications Needed Knowledge of higher education research, including the funding landscape; Knowledge of the areas of engagement, priorities and requirements of key funders; Excellent numeracy skills, competent working with complex project budgets, demonstrating accuracy and attention to detail; Ability effectively to organise and prioritise work and follow procedures, in order to produce work to a high standard to required deadlines; Proactive approach to solving complex problems, including resolving issues escalated from the team; Experience of supporting and mentoring junior staff is desirable.
